In my hypothetical case, I guess the victim's cardiovascular system
would go out of control from the stress and pain.
Extreme stress can kill either by overworking the heart [sympathetic
overload] or relaxing it way too much [parasympathetic overreaction].
If the cardiovascular system is over-stimulated, the heartbeat can
become disorderly and the 4 chambers of the heart stop communicating
with each other. This can be fatal on its own. In other cases, after
over-stimulation, blood pressure rises excessively, this causes the
parasympthetic nervous system to kick in which in turn results in a
decrease in the strength and speed of the heart. This causes a dramatic
decrease in blood pressure. To make things worse, the parasympthetic
system causes blood vessels around the body to widen causing blood
pressure to fall even further. This extremely low blood pressure
results in loss of blood supply to vital organs and is therefore fatal.
Is my guess correct?

Your "partial" thickness burn, when affecting over 90% of the body can
be fatal for two main reasons; dehydration and infection. Your burn
wound would leak live a sieve. With burn injuries, the first 72 hours
focuses almost solely on fluid and pain management. Partial thickness
burns are more painful because the nerve endings are still intact. And
they leak fluids because the capillaries are still viable.
Your view of the sympathetic and parasympathetic nervous system and
it's effects on cardiac function is straight out of a textbook, ie. in
a vacuum, so while academically correct, ignores many other
physiologic influences and demands.
Again, such patients are usually purposely sedated and then chemically
paralyzed to decrease the amount of oxygen demand overall. Blood
pressure, as a measure of systemic vascular resistence, must be kept
low, allowing the heart to pump against less pressure; hence
increasing cardiac output and systemic perfusion. If myoglobin from
deteriorating muscle mass accumulates, such patients may undergo
hemodialysis to preclude permanent renal damage. If charring around
the chest occurs, emergency escharotomy may need to be performed to
facilitate chest wall expansion. If lung searing from inhaled heat
occurred, then there may be either a pneumo or hemothorax, requiring a
chest tube. Steroids to bolster cellular integrity, antibiotics to
fight infection, and constant monitoring in an ICU that specializes in
burn care may save such a person's life. He or she would still look
like shit and need skin grafts and or transplants.
On this note, just a bit of FYI to anyone reading: NEVER TREAT A FRESH
BURN WITH BUTTER OR ANY OTHER THICK GREASE. IT SEALS IN THE HEAT SO
THAT THE BURN DAMAGE CONTINUES.
You treat a burn with a quick application of cold water, wet
dressings, and a trip to the Emergency Department.

| He had 70% of his body burned. He went from
being 135 to 78 pounds. From his chin to his groin
in front. Neck to butt in back. Both arms and both
legs to feet. Your brain does know how to walk but
the body wasnt willing. As far as talking the throat
was scorched on the inside hence words wouldnt
pronounce right.
